- FHFA House Price Index values in ZIP 46321 (Munster, IN) rose +1.2% from 2023 to 2024. The all-transactions index moved from 201.1 in 2023 to 203.4 in 2024 (2000 = 100).
ZIP code 46321 is a densely settled 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Munster, Lake County, Indiana, with 23,603 residents across 19.6 square miles, a density of 1,204 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 46321 skews affluent, with a median household income of $110,187 (50% above the average Indiana ZIP), while per-capita income is $57,382. The poverty rate is 6.0%, with unemployment at 5.5%; those measures add context to the income figure. Housing is both higher-cost and owner-heavy: median home value is $334,300 (73% above the average Indiana ZIP), while 87.0% of occupied homes are owner-occupied and median rent is $1,507.
A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 49.9%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 45, and the average commute is 28 minutes. Home values in ZIP 46321 have increased 1.2%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+103% cumulative appreciation.
| Year | Annual Change | HPI Index |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| +3.5% | 150 |
| 2021 | +11.8% | 168 |
| 2022 | +10.0% | 185 |
| 2023 | +8.7% | 201 |
| 2024 | +1.2% | 203 |
Source: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index, All-Transactions, Five-Digit ZIP Codes (Developmental Index). Index base = 100 in year 2000. Data through 2024. ZIP codes with few transactions may show missing values.
What businesses operate in this ZIP?
Census Bureau data shows 689 business establishments in ZIP 46321, employing approximately 15,460 people with a combined annual payroll of $972,574,000.
